Detail 01
Small and high-pitched. Speaks instantly and dies fast, so accents land without ringing over the next bar.
Detail 02
Sabian's bright, modern voice. Cuts cleanly and stays articulate rather than washing out.
Detail 03
An effect voice, not a main crash. Very short decay, low volume, meant for punctuation rather than sustained accents.
Detail 04
Priced as a professional accent cymbal. Cheaper than a full crash because of the smaller size, not lower build tier.

Short, bright accents. It speaks instantly and stops almost immediately, so you can punctuate a groove or fill without adding sustained wash over the next beat.
It is the common starting size. Smaller splashes are higher and shorter; larger ones give a bit more body. A 10 sits in the middle and works on most kits.
Either on its own short cymbal stand or on a clamp attached to an existing stand or arm. Neither is included.
No. A splash is quieter and decays too fast to function as a main crash. It is a supplemental accent voice alongside a full-size crash.
